Lucid Gamme Lucid - utilitaires ou VUS
Lucid's SUV lineup is embodied by the Gravity, a luxury electric crossover that entered production in late 2024 and was delivered from 2025. Designed from a clean sheet, it offers the interior space and practicality of a large SUV within the exterior footprint of a mid-size model, with up to about 120 cu ft of total cargo space and a five- or seven-seat configuration. It targets families and affluent buyers looking for a versatile, high-performance vehicle with long range. The Gravity adopts very large wheels, up to 22 or 23 inches depending on the version, in a staggered setup. In Quebec, planning for a dedicated set of winter tires, ideally on smaller-diameter wheels, improves traction on snow and ice while preserving winter range, which is often reduced by cold on electric vehicles.

Technology
Technologies, engines and platforms
The Gravity uses high-density Panasonic cylindrical cells, a dual-motor powertrain with all-wheel drive delivering from 560 to over 800 hp, Lucid's high-voltage architecture, ultra-fast charging, and the NACS port with bidirectional charging.
Tires and wheels
Tire and wheel compatibility
Les véhicules Lucid roulent sur de grandes jantes : la berline Air propose typiquement des diamètres de 19, 20 et 21 pouces, souvent en montage étagé (pneus avant plus étroits que l'arrière), avec un entraxe courant de 5x120 mm. Le VUS Gravity monte des jantes encore plus grandes, jusqu'à 22 ou 23 pouces. Au Québec, où les pneus d'hiver sont obligatoires, un second train monté sur jantes de plus petit diamètre est souvent judicieux pour préserver l'autonomie, améliorer l'adhérence et réduire le coût des pneus hiver. Vérifiez toujours les dimensions exactes, l'entraxe, l'alésage central et l'indice de charge propres à la version avant tout achat.
